The basis of impressive vocal singing is rooted in perfecting vocal training techniques. Professional educators highlight the essentiality of fully understanding the way the singing system functions, covering the coordination between the diaphragm, larynx, and resonating chambers. These vocal training techniques include correct stance, jaw alignment, and tongue positioning, each of which contributes significantly to singing quality and stamina. Breath control exercises act as the cornerstone of singing resilience and longevity, allowing singers to sustain power and definition as they perform. Diaphragmatic breathing teaches artists to tap into their full lung capacity while ensuring consistent air stream that enhances prolonged notes and intricate phrases. Typically, these breath control exercises begin with simple breathing patterns that incrementally increase in difficulty, incorporating holds, releases, and regulated breathing methods. For pitch accuracy improvement, a vocalist demands dedicated effort and a profound understanding of melodic intervals and tonal relationships. Vocalists should hone their ear training in conjunction with their vocal proficiency, acquiring the skill to identify and mimic distinctive pitches with impeccable musicality.
